JUST IN: Police arrest two, recover 48 mobile phones in Katsina

The Katsina State Police Command has arrested two suspected criminals, referred to locally as Kauraye, for breaking into a shop and stealing 48 mobile phones.

 

 

 

The Katsina State Police Command’s Public Relations Officer, CSP Gambo Isah, disclosed this on Friday.

 

 

 

Isah disclosed that the two suspects, Abubakar Haruna, 23, and Ibrahim Sani, 22, were arrested in Katsina on Wednesday for stealing 48 mobile phones from a mobile phone dealer’s shop at Tsohuwar Tasha, Katsina.

 

 

 

The suspects, he said, were apprehended based on credible intelligence, alleging that they conspired with another suspect, Tayi, who is currently at large. The suspects, he said, have confessed to the crime, adding that they revealed they planned to sell the phones in a neighboring country.
